noun, noun or participle which takes 'suru', transitive verb, intransitive verb
turning upside down; inverting vertically
A Sino-Japanese technical or formal term for placing or showing something upside down, especially by reversing top and bottom. In everyday speech, 逆さにする is often more natural.
画像を上下に倒置して表示する。
Display the image upside down.

noun, noun or participle which takes 'suru', transitive verb, intransitive verb
inversion; inverted word order
Grammar term for reversing the normal word order, often for emphasis or stylistic effect. Commonly appears in discussions of grammar, rhetoric, and translation.
この文では、強調のために語順が倒置されている。
In this sentence, the word order is inverted for emphasis.
英語では、疑問文で主語と助動詞が倒置することがある。
In English, the subject and auxiliary verb may invert in questions.
